首页 > 精选问答 >

什么是38译码器啊

2025-11-18 10:23:54

问题描述:

什么是38译码器啊希望能解答下

最佳答案

推荐答案

2025-11-18 10:23:54

什么是38译码器啊】在数字电路中,译码器是一种重要的组合逻辑电路,用于将输入的二进制代码转换为对应的输出信号。其中,“38译码器”通常指的是一个具有3个输入端和8个输出端的译码器,也称为3-8线译码器。它能够根据输入的3位二进制代码,选择并激活其中一个输出端。

下面是关于38译码器的详细说明:

一、38译码器的基本概念

项目 内容
名称 3-8线译码器(38译码器)
输入位数 3位二进制信号(A2, A1, A0)
输出位数 8个独立的输出信号(Y0 ~ Y7)
功能 根据输入的3位二进制代码,选择对应的输出通道进行激活
应用场景 数据选择、地址解码、控制信号生成等

二、工作原理简述

38译码器的核心是将3位二进制输入转换成8种不同的状态。每个输入组合对应一个唯一的输出信号。例如:

- 当输入为000时,Y0被激活;

- 当输入为001时,Y1被激活;

- 依此类推,直到输入为111时,Y7被激活。

这种译码方式可以看作是对二进制数的“展开”,即每一位输入都参与决定哪一个输出被选中。

三、典型应用

应用场景 说明
地址解码 在存储器或I/O设备中,用于选择特定的地址
控制信号生成 在控制系统中,根据输入选择不同的控制路径
多路选择器辅助 与多路选择器结合使用,实现数据路由功能

四、38译码器的逻辑表达式(以74LS138为例)

74LS138是一个常见的3-8线译码器芯片,其逻辑表达式如下:

- Y0 = A2' · A1' · A0'

- Y1 = A2' · A1' · A0

- Y2 = A2' · A1 · A0'

- Y3 = A2' · A1 · A0

- Y4 = A2 · A1' · A0'

- Y5 = A2 · A1' · A0

- Y6 = A2 · A1 · A0'

- Y7 = A2 · A1 · A0

其中,“·”表示逻辑与,“'”表示取反。

五、总结

38译码器是一种将3位二进制输入转换为8个独立输出信号的数字电路。它在数字系统中广泛应用,特别是在需要根据输入选择特定输出路径的场合。通过理解其工作原理和逻辑表达式,可以更好地掌握其在实际电路中的应用方法。

如需进一步了解其他类型的译码器(如4-16线译码器),可继续提问。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。